/external/llvm/lib/Target/AMDGPU/InstPrinter/ |
AMDGPUInstPrinter.h | 38 void printU8ImmO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 39 void printU16ImmO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 40 void printU8ImmDecO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 41 void printU16ImmDecO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 42 void printU32ImmO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 43 void printOffen(const MCInst *MI, unsigned OpNo, raw_ostream &O); 44 void printIdxen(const MCInst *MI, unsigned OpNo, raw_ostream &O); 45 void printAddr64(const MCInst *MI, unsigned OpNo, raw_ostream &O); 46 void printMBUFOffset(const MCInst *MI, unsigned OpNo, raw_ostream &O); 47 void printDSOffset(const MCInst *MI, unsigned OpNo, raw_ostream &O) [all...] |
AMDGPUInstPrinter.cpp | 30 void AMDGPUInstPrinter::printU8ImmOperand(const MCInst *MI, unsigned OpNo, 32 O << formatHex(MI->getOperand(OpNo).getImm() & 0xff); 35 void AMDGPUInstPrinter::printU16ImmOperand(const MCInst *MI, unsigned OpNo, 37 O << formatHex(MI->getOperand(OpNo).getImm() & 0xffff); 40 void AMDGPUInstPrinter::printU32ImmOperand(const MCInst *MI, unsigned OpNo, 42 O << formatHex(MI->getOperand(OpNo).getImm() & 0xffffffff); 45 void AMDGPUInstPrinter::printU8ImmDecOperand(const MCInst *MI, unsigned OpNo, 47 O << formatDec(MI->getOperand(OpNo).getImm() & 0xff); 50 void AMDGPUInstPrinter::printU16ImmDecOperand(const MCInst *MI, unsigned OpNo, 52 O << formatDec(MI->getOperand(OpNo).getImm() & 0xffff) [all...] |
/external/llvm/lib/Target/X86/InstPrinter/ |
X86ATTInstPrinter.h | 44 void printOperand(const MCInst *MI, unsigned OpNo, raw_ostream &OS); 48 void printPCRelImm(const MCInst *MI, unsigned OpNo, raw_ostream &OS); 49 void printSrcIdx(const MCInst *MI, unsigned OpNo, raw_ostream &OS); 50 void printDstIdx(const MCInst *MI, unsigned OpNo, raw_ostream &OS); 51 void printMemOffset(const MCInst *MI, unsigned OpNo, raw_ostream &OS); 55 void printanymem(const MCInst *MI, unsigned OpNo, raw_ostream &O) { 56 printMemReference(MI, OpNo, O); 59 void printopaquemem(const MCInst *MI, unsigned OpNo, raw_ostream &O) { 60 printMemReference(MI, OpNo, O); 63 void printi8mem(const MCInst *MI, unsigned OpNo, raw_ostream &O) [all...] |
X86IntelInstPrinter.h | 38 void printO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 42 void printPCRelImm(const MCInst *MI, unsigned OpNo, raw_ostream &O); 43 void printMemOffset(const MCInst *MI, unsigned OpNo, raw_ostream &O); 44 void printSrcIdx(const MCInst *MI, unsigned OpNo, raw_ostream &O); 45 void printDstIdx(const MCInst *MI, unsigned OpNo, raw_ostream &O); 49 void printanymem(const MCInst *MI, unsigned OpNo, raw_ostream &O) { 50 printMemReference(MI, OpNo, O); 53 void printopaquemem(const MCInst *MI, unsigned OpNo, raw_ostream &O) { 55 printMemReference(MI, OpNo, O); 58 void printi8mem(const MCInst *MI, unsigned OpNo, raw_ostream &O) [all...] |
/external/llvm/lib/Target/Hexagon/MCTargetDesc/ |
HexagonInstPrinter.h | 39 void printOperand(MCInst const *MI, unsigned OpNo, raw_ostream &O) const; 40 void printExtOperand(MCInst const *MI, unsigned OpNo, raw_ostream &O) const; 41 void printUnsignedImmOperand(MCInst const *MI, unsigned OpNo, 43 void printNegImmOperand(MCInst const *MI, unsigned OpNo, 45 void printNOneImmOperand(MCInst const *MI, unsigned OpNo, 47 void prints3_6ImmOperand(MCInst const *MI, unsigned OpNo, 49 void prints3_7ImmOperand(MCInst const *MI, unsigned OpNo, 51 void prints4_6ImmOperand(MCInst const *MI, unsigned OpNo, 53 void prints4_7ImmOperand(MCInst const *MI, unsigned OpNo, 55 void printBranchOperand(MCInst const *MI, unsigned OpNo, [all...] |
HexagonInstPrinter.cpp | 89 void HexagonInstPrinter::printOperand(MCInst const *MI, unsigned OpNo, 91 if (HexagonMCInstrInfo::getExtendableOp(MII, *MI) == OpNo && 94 MCOperand const &MO = MI->getOperand(OpNo); 108 void HexagonInstPrinter::printExtOperand(MCInst const *MI, unsigned OpNo, 110 printOperand(MI, OpNo, O); 114 unsigned OpNo, 116 O << MI->getOperand(OpNo).getImm(); 119 void HexagonInstPrinter::printNegImmOperand(MCInst const *MI, unsigned OpNo, 121 O << -MI->getOperand(OpNo).getImm(); 124 void HexagonInstPrinter::printNOneImmOperand(MCInst const *MI, unsigned OpNo, [all...] |
/external/mesa3d/src/gallium/drivers/radeon/ |
AMDGPUCodeEmitter.h | 25 unsigned OpNo) const { 29 unsigned OpNo) const { 37 unsigned OpNo) const { 40 virtual uint32_t SMRDmemriEncode(const MachineInstr &MI, unsigned OpNo)
|
/external/llvm/lib/Target/PowerPC/InstPrinter/ |
PPCInstPrinter.h | 47 void printO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 48 void printPredicateOperand(const MCInst *MI, unsigned OpNo, 51 void printU1ImmO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 52 void printU2ImmO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 53 void printU3ImmO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 54 void printU4ImmO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 55 void printS5ImmO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 56 void printU5ImmO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 57 void printU6ImmO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 58 void printU10ImmO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O) [all...] |
PPCInstPrinter.cpp | 156 void PPCInstPrinter::printPredicateOperand(const MCInst *MI, unsigned OpNo, 159 unsigned Code = MI->getOperand(OpNo).getImm(); 250 printOperand(MI, OpNo+1, O); 253 void PPCInstPrinter::printU1ImmOperand(const MCInst *MI, unsigned OpNo, 255 unsigned int Value = MI->getOperand(OpNo).getImm(); 260 void PPCInstPrinter::printU2ImmOperand(const MCInst *MI, unsigned OpNo, 262 unsigned int Value = MI->getOperand(OpNo).getImm(); 267 void PPCInstPrinter::printU3ImmOperand(const MCInst *MI, unsigned OpNo, 269 unsigned int Value = MI->getOperand(OpNo).getImm(); 274 void PPCInstPrinter::printU4ImmOperand(const MCInst *MI, unsigned OpNo, [all...] |
/external/llvm/lib/Target/Mips/MCTargetDesc/ |
MipsMCCodeEmitter.h | 67 unsigned getJumpTargetOpValue(const MCInst &MI, unsigned OpNo, 74 unsigned getJumpTargetOpValueMM(const MCInst &MI, unsigned OpNo, 80 unsigned getUImm5Lsl2Encoding(const MCInst &MI, unsigned OpNo, 84 unsigned getSImm3Lsa2Value(const MCInst &MI, unsigned OpNo, 88 unsigned getUImm6Lsl2Encoding(const MCInst &MI, unsigned OpNo, 94 unsigned getSImm9AddiuspValue(const MCInst &MI, unsigned OpNo, 101 unsigned getBranchTargetOpValue(const MCInst &MI, unsigned OpNo, 108 unsigned getBranchTarget7OpValueMM(const MCInst &MI, unsigned OpNo, 115 unsigned getBranchTargetOpValueMMPC10(const MCInst &MI, unsigned OpNo, 122 unsigned getBranchTargetOpValueMM(const MCInst &MI, unsigned OpNo, [all...] |
MipsMCCodeEmitter.cpp | 221 getBranchTargetOpValue(const MCInst &MI, unsigned OpNo, 225 const MCOperand &MO = MI.getOperand(OpNo); 244 getBranchTarget7OpValueMM(const MCInst &MI, unsigned OpNo, 248 const MCOperand &MO = MI.getOperand(OpNo); 266 getBranchTargetOpValueMMPC10(const MCInst &MI, unsigned OpNo, 270 const MCOperand &MO = MI.getOperand(OpNo); 288 getBranchTargetOpValueMM(const MCInst &MI, unsigned OpNo, 292 const MCOperand &MO = MI.getOperand(OpNo); 311 getBranchTarget21OpValue(const MCInst &MI, unsigned OpNo, 315 const MCOperand &MO = MI.getOperand(OpNo); [all...] |
/external/mesa3d/src/gallium/drivers/radeon/InstPrinter/ |
AMDGPUInstPrinter.cpp | 14 void AMDGPUInstPrinter::printOperand(const MCInst *MI, unsigned OpNo, 17 const MCOperand &Op = MI->getOperand(OpNo); 29 void AMDGPUInstPrinter::printMemOperand(const MCInst *MI, unsigned OpNo, 31 printOperand(MI, OpNo, O);
|
AMDGPUInstPrinter.h | 25 void printO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 26 // void printUnsignedImm(const MCInst *MI, int OpNo, raw_ostream &O); 27 void printMemO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O);
|
/external/llvm/lib/Target/PowerPC/MCTargetDesc/ |
PPCMCCodeEmitter.cpp | 51 unsigned getDirectBrEncoding(const MCInst &MI, unsigned OpNo, 54 unsigned getCondBrEncoding(const MCInst &MI, unsigned OpNo, 57 unsigned getAbsDirectBrEncoding(const MCInst &MI, unsigned OpNo, 60 unsigned getAbsCondBrEncoding(const MCInst &MI, unsigned OpNo, 63 unsigned getImm16Encoding(const MCInst &MI, unsigned OpNo, 66 unsigned getMemRIEncoding(const MCInst &MI, unsigned OpNo, 69 unsigned getMemRIXEncoding(const MCInst &MI, unsigned OpNo, 72 unsigned getSPE8DisEncoding(const MCInst &MI, unsigned OpNo, 75 unsigned getSPE4DisEncoding(const MCInst &MI, unsigned OpNo, 78 unsigned getSPE2DisEncoding(const MCInst &MI, unsigned OpNo, [all...] |
/external/llvm/lib/Target/MSP430/InstPrinter/ |
MSP430InstPrinter.cpp | 35 void MSP430InstPrinter::printPCRelImmOperand(const MCInst *MI, unsigned OpNo, 37 const MCOperand &Op = MI->getOperand(OpNo); 46 void MSP430InstPrinter::printOperand(const MCInst *MI, unsigned OpNo, 49 const MCOperand &Op = MI->getOperand(OpNo); 61 void MSP430InstPrinter::printSrcMemOperand(const MCInst *MI, unsigned OpNo, 64 const MCOperand &Base = MI->getOperand(OpNo); 65 const MCOperand &Disp = MI->getOperand(OpNo+1); 90 void MSP430InstPrinter::printCCOperand(const MCInst *MI, unsigned OpNo, 92 unsigned CC = MI->getOperand(OpNo).getImm();
|
MSP430InstPrinter.h | 35 void printO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O, 37 void printPCRelImmO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O); 38 void printSrcMemO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O, 40 void printCCO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O);
|
/external/llvm/lib/Target/BPF/InstPrinter/ |
BPFInstPrinter.h | 30 void printOperand(const MCInst *MI, unsigned OpNo, raw_ostream &O, 32 void printMemOperand(const MCInst *MI, int OpNo, raw_ostream &O, 34 void printImm64Operand(const MCInst *MI, unsigned OpNo, raw_ostream &O);
|
BPFInstPrinter.cpp | 52 void BPFInstPrinter::printOperand(const MCInst *MI, unsigned OpNo, 55 const MCOperand &Op = MI->getOperand(OpNo); 66 void BPFInstPrinter::printMemOperand(const MCInst *MI, int OpNo, raw_ostream &O, 68 const MCOperand &RegOp = MI->getOperand(OpNo); 69 const MCOperand &OffsetOp = MI->getOperand(OpNo + 1); 81 void BPFInstPrinter::printImm64Operand(const MCInst *MI, unsigned OpNo, 83 const MCOperand &Op = MI->getOperand(OpNo);
|
/external/mesa3d/src/gallium/drivers/radeon/MCTargetDesc/ |
AMDGPUMCCodeEmitter.h | 36 virtual unsigned GPR4AlignEncode(const MCInst &MI, unsigned OpNo, 40 virtual unsigned GPR2AlignEncode(const MCInst &MI, unsigned OpNo, 47 virtual uint64_t i32LiteralEncode(const MCInst &MI, unsigned OpNo, 51 virtual uint32_t SMRDmemriEncode(const MCInst &MI, unsigned OpNo,
|
SIMCCodeEmitter.cpp | 84 unsigned GPRAlign(const MCInst &MI, unsigned OpNo, unsigned shift) const; 87 virtual unsigned GPR2AlignEncode(const MCInst &MI, unsigned OpNo, 91 virtual unsigned GPR4AlignEncode(const MCInst &MI, unsigned OpNo, 96 virtual uint64_t i32LiteralEncode(const MCInst &MI, unsigned OpNo, 100 virtual uint32_t SMRDmemriEncode(const MCInst &MI, unsigned OpNo, 161 unsigned SIMCCodeEmitter::GPRAlign(const MCInst &MI, unsigned OpNo, 163 unsigned regCode = getRegBinaryCode(MI.getOperand(OpNo).getReg()); 168 unsigned OpNo , 170 return GPRAlign(MI, OpNo, 1); 174 unsigned OpNo, [all...] |
/external/llvm/lib/Target/Hexagon/ |
HexagonAsmPrinter.h | 49 void printOperand(const MachineInstr *MI, unsigned OpNo, raw_ostream &O); 50 bool PrintAsmOperand(const MachineInstr *MI, unsigned OpNo, 53 bool PrintAsmMemoryOperand(const MachineInstr *MI, unsigned OpNo,
|
/external/llvm/lib/Target/SystemZ/ |
SystemZAsmPrinter.h | 35 bool PrintAsmOperand(const MachineInstr *MI, unsigned OpNo, 38 bool PrintAsmMemoryOperand(const MachineInstr *MI, unsigned OpNo,
|
/external/llvm/lib/Target/Mips/ |
MipsSERegisterInfo.h | 34 void eliminateFI(MachineBasicBlock::iterator II, unsigned OpNo,
|
Mips16RegisterInfo.cpp | 80 unsigned OpNo, int FrameIndex, 113 if ((MI.getNumOperands()> OpNo+2) && MI.getOperand(OpNo+2).isReg()) 114 FrameReg = MI.getOperand(OpNo+2).getReg(); 131 Offset += MI.getOperand(OpNo + 1).getImm(); 147 MI.getOperand(OpNo).ChangeToRegister(FrameReg, false, false, IsKill); 148 MI.getOperand(OpNo + 1).ChangeToImmediate(Offset);
|
/external/llvm/lib/CodeGen/AsmPrinter/ |
AsmPrinterInlineAsm.cpp | 212 unsigned OpNo = InlineAsm::MIOp_FirstOperand; 218 if (OpNo >= MI->getNumOperands()) break; 219 unsigned OpFlags = MI->getOperand(OpNo).getImm(); 220 OpNo += InlineAsm::getNumOperandRegisters(OpFlags) + 1; 226 if (OpNo >= MI->getNumOperands() || 227 MI->getOperand(OpNo).isMetadata()) { 230 unsigned OpFlags = MI->getOperand(OpNo).getImm(); 231 ++OpNo; // Skip over the ID number. 234 Error = AP->PrintAsmMemoryOperand(MI, OpNo, InlineAsmVariant, 237 Error = AP->PrintAsmOperand(MI, OpNo, InlineAsmVariant [all...] |